                 129  The Union has exclusive legislative authority in the following matters:
                     "Labour relations and social security; real estate and expropriation in
                     the public interest; extradition of criminals; banks; insurance of all
                     kinds; protection of agricultural and animal wealth; major legislation
                     relating to penal law, civil and commercial transactions and company
                     law, procedures before the civil and criminal courts; protection of
                     cultural, technical and industrial property and copyright; printing and
                     publishing; import of arms and ammunitions except for use by the
                     armed forces or the security forces belonging to any emirate; other
                     aviation affairs which are not within the executive jurisdiction of the
                     Union; delimitation of territorial waters and regulation of navigation on
                     the high seas." (Article 121).
                 130  It is, however, not made entirely clear in the text of Article 47, paragraph
                    2, whether this means that absolutely all Union laws are subject to this
                     procedure; the text in English is vague; "Sanction of various Union laws
                     before their promulgation.” In other parts of the constitution provision
                     is made for retroactive approval of already promulgated laws if the
                     Supreme Council cannot be summoned in time (Article 113).

                 134  The first published translation of the Provisional Constitution uses the
                    term  Union National Assembly for al majlis al walani al ittihadi but
                    later the parliament became known in English as the Federal National
                    Council (FNC).                                         f
                135  Eight each from Abu Dhabi and Dubai, six each from Sharjah and Ra s
                    al Khaimah, and four each from 'Ajman, Umm al Qaiwain and Fujairah.
